    This week’s seasonal spotlight is asparagus — fresh, flavorful, and only in season until the end of June! 🌿

    Our chef has created a delicious and nutritionally balanced dish just for our kids, using asparagus — a true superfood loaded with iron, zinc, riboflavin, fiber, and vitamin K, which supports bone health, digestion, and immune function. It was served with a bowl of green salad as a starter.

     Eating seasonal means better taste, nutrition, and a more sustainable planet.

     Healthy and yummy quinoa with asparagus
     Serves 4

    Ingredients

    • 450 gr quinoa (rinsed)
    • 1 bunch of asparagus (chopped)
    • 2 red bell peppers (diced)
    • 220 gr. chickpeas (one jar of cooked chickpeas, drained)
    • 50 ml olive oil
    • Salt, pepper, curry, oregano, garlic powder, sweet paprika
    • 150 gr grated Mozzarella 

     

    Instructions

    1. Cook the quinoa in boiling water for about 15 minutes.
    2. Peel the asparagus and cook it until it softens.
    3. Heat half of the olive oil in a pan and sauté the chopped bell peppers.
    4. Add the chopped asparagus, drained chickpeas and spices, and stir briefly.
    5. Serve the quinoa with the vegetable mix on top.
    6. Sprinkle with grated mozzarella cheese and drizzle with the remaining olive oil.
